Linux中mysql命令写错了

fiy 其他 63

回复

共3条回复 我来回复
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    在Linux中,如果你发现你的mysql命令写错了,可以采取以下几个步骤来纠正:

    1. 检查命令语法:首先,确认你输入的mysql命令的语法是否正确。查阅mysql的官方文档,或者使用命令`mysql –help`来获取相关命令的使用方式和选项。

    2. 检查命令拼写:如果你确定命令的语法是正确的,那么请仔细检查你所输入的命令是否有拼写错误。Linux对大小写是敏感的,所以确保你输入的命令正确地使用了大小写。

    3. 查找错误信息:运行mysql命令时,如果你遇到了任何错误信息,那么请仔细阅读和理解这些错误信息。错误信息通常会提供有关命令错误的详细信息,帮助你找到问题所在。你可以使用命令`sudo grep -r “error_message” /var/log`来在系统日志中搜索相关错误信息。

    4. 检查数据库连接:如果你的mysql命令包含了与数据库的连接操作,那么请确保你的数据库服务器正在运行,并且你所使用的连接参数是正确的。你可以尝试使用命令`mysqladmin ping`来检查数据库服务器的连接是否正常。

    5. 使用备份命令:如果你的mysql命令执行后导致了数据的不可逆性损坏,那么请确保你有数据库的备份。可以使用命令`mysqldump`来进行数据库的备份和恢复。

    总之,当你发现mysql命令写错了,在Linux中,你需要仔细检查命令的语法、拼写和数据库连接,并借助错误信息来定位问题所在。同时,务必确保你有数据库的备份,以防止数据损坏。希望以上的建议对你有所帮助。

    2年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    在Linux中,如果你写错了mysql命令,可能会导致执行失败或者产生意想不到的结果。以下是一些常见的mysql命令写错的情况及如何解决的方法:

    1. 语法错误:在输入mysql命令时,必须按照正确的语法格式进行输入。如果你忘记了某个关键字、括号或者分号,命令将无法正确执行。解决方法是仔细检查命令语法,以确保所有的关键字和符号都正确匹配。

    2. 数据库不存在:如果你使用了一个不存在的数据库名,mysql命令将会报错。首先,你可以通过输入 “show databases;” 命令来查看当前存在的数据库。如果数据库不存在,你需要通过 “create database” 命令来创建一个新的数据库。

    3. 表不存在:如果你使用了一个不存在的表名,mysql命令将会报错。你可以使用 “use database_name;” 命令选择要使用的数据库,然后通过 “show tables;” 命令来查看当前存在的表。如果表不存在,你可以通过 “create table” 命令来创建一个新的表。

    4. 用户名或密码错误:当你使用mysql命令连接到数据库服务器时,需要提供正确的用户名和密码才能成功登录。如果你输入的用户名或密码错误,mysql命令将会报错。解决方法是确保输入的用户名和密码正确,并且区分大小写。

    5. 权限问题:如果你使用的是普通用户账户登录到mysql数据库服务器,并且没有足够的权限执行某个命令,mysql命令将会报错。你可以尝试使用管理员账户登录,或者联系数据库管理员来获取足够的权限。

    总之,当mysql命令写错时,你需要仔细检查命令的语法和参数,确保输入的数据库名、表名、用户名和密码等都是正确的。在排除语法错误和拼写错误后,如果问题仍然存在,你可以尝试查询相关文档或者寻求专业人士的帮助来解决问题。

    2年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    在Linux中,使用mysql命令进行对MySQL数据库的操作非常常见。然而,有时候由于操作失误或者其他原因,可能会出现mysql命令写错的情况。下面将详细介绍在Linux中如何处理mysql命令写错的情况。

    1. 检查语法错误

    如果你发现mysql命令写错了,首先需要检查是否存在语法错误。你可以通过在命令行中输入mysql命令的正确语法来检查。如果出现语法错误,一般会在命令行中显示错误消息,指出错误的位置。根据错误信息,你可以修改命令并重新执行。

    2. 使用历史命令

    如果你曾经执行过正确的mysql命令,但是现在写错了,可以通过使用历史命令来解决。在Linux中,可以使用上箭头键或者输入”history”命令来查看之前执行过的命令。通过找到正确的mysql命令并复制到当前命令行中,然后修改为正确的命令,再次执行即可。

    3. 使用备份文件

    如果你在写错mysql命令之前创建了数据库备份文件,可以将备份文件还原到MySQL中。首先,使用”mysql -u [用户名] -p”命令登录到MySQL;然后,使用”source [备份文件路径]”命令来导入备份文件到MySQL。注意,这种方法需要确保你在写错mysql命令之前创建了可用的备份文件。

    4. 回滚操作

    如果你写错mysql命令之后进行了一系列操作,而且没有备份文件可用,那么可以使用回滚操作来还原到写错之前的状态。MySQL提供了回滚事务的功能,可以将数据库还原到之前的状态。需要注意的是,回滚操作只适用于事务(包含一系列操作的组合),并且该事务必须启动了。

    5. 参考MySQL文档

    如果以上的方法都无法解决你写错mysql命令的问题,你可以参考MySQL官方文档。MySQL官方文档提供了详细的命令说明和使用方法,你可以在文档中查找相关命令的正确写法和用法。使用合适的命令可以避免错误,并且更加高效。

    总结:在Linux中,如果mysql命令写错了,你可以通过检查语法错误、使用历史命令、使用备份文件、回滚操作或者参考MySQL文档等方法来解决问题。根据具体情况选择合适的方法,以恢复到正常的操作状态。

    2年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部